Beat Cravings




Combating cravings can be tough, but a detailed schedule and a healthy activity plan, which you can create in your journal, will help you overcome these Habits of Disease.

BEAT CRAVINGS WITH A PLAN

Keeping a journal is a great way to go from mindless to mindful as you move toward Optimal Health. Tracking your daily intake, thoughts, successes, and failures helps you learn what works and where you're struggling. But you already knew that, right?
Choosing an activity over eating is especially helpful when you’re dealing with a stressful day and looking for comfort food. Get away from the areas that cause the stress, and take a walk, listen to music, or choose from your chore list. It may also help to ask yourself whether the action you’re contemplating supports your primary choice to reach a healthy weight.

To help you beat your cravings, write down 10 activities that you can do around the house or office when you feel stress or a craving. Note these activities in your journal.


Cravings might be a challenge at first, but stick to the program.
